Our Public Sector Client requires a Senior Information Management Architect (10+ Years) with experience supporting the implementation of M365 and SharePoint Online.
Full time, % remote
Responsibilities to Include:
- Conduct a functional decomposition of current systems and processes to translate into SharePoint Online elements, including libraries, sites, and metadata management.
- Meet with clients to understand and document their information management needs and develop information architecture that aligns with those needs.
- Design and implement classification structures, metadata models, and retention/disposition schedules within SharePoint Online.
- Lead the creation of electronic file plans and integrate these into SharePoint, ensuring compliance with GOC standards and retention policies.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to develop and input information structures and metadata into SharePoint solutions, shifting from paper-based to electronic systems.
- Provide guidance on the use of SharePoint for information management, including best practices for document management, data retention, and information security.
- Work closely with the M Migration team to align information management architecture with enterprise-level governance, policies, and lifecycle requirements.
- Create bilingual taxonomies and data dictionaries within the IM architecture to support the integration of GCDocs and M/SharePoint Online.
- Advise senior management and project teams on IM best practices, tools, and risk management strategies related to information governance and lifecycle.
- Utilize knowledge of various electronic systems (e.g., GCDocs, SharePoint on-prem, RDIMS, InforBank) to recommend and implement best-fit solutions.
Must Haves:
- 10+ years of experience as an Information Management Architect.
- Experience with Classification Structures.
- Experience with Metadata Models.
- Experience with Retention/Disposition Schedules.
- Familiarity with Generic Valuation Tools (GVT) and the ability to align information management strategies with GOC retention and disposition standards.
- Proven experience in supporting the implementation of M and SharePoint Online as an electronic document/records management solution (EDRMS).
Nice to Haves:
- Experience in developing and presenting recommendations for alternative Systems that Manage Information (SMI) tools based on SharePoint on-prem, OpenText Content Server, or M SharePoint Online.
- Bilingual proficiency (English and French).
